The Standard Voltage of a Car Battery

The vast majority of standard 12-volt lead-acid car batteries found in automobiles today operate at a nominal voltage of 12 volts. This means that under normal operating conditions, the battery’s terminals will have a potential difference of 12 volts. It’s important to note that this is a nominal value, and the actual voltage can fluctuate slightly depending on factors like the battery’s charge level, temperature, and age.

Why 12 Volts?

The choice of 12 volts as the standard for car batteries stems from a combination of historical precedent, technological feasibility, and practical considerations. Early automobiles relied on 6-volt batteries, but as electrical systems became more complex and demanding, the need for higher voltage became apparent. 12 volts offered a good balance between power and safety, allowing for the operation of increasingly sophisticated electrical components without compromising the safety of the driver or passengers.

Beyond the Standard: Alternative Battery Voltages

While 12 volts reigns supreme in the automotive world, there are exceptions. Some specialized vehicles, such as heavy-duty trucks, buses, and recreational vehicles (RVs), may utilize batteries with higher voltages, typically 24 volts or even 48 volts. This is often necessary to handle the increased electrical demands of these larger vehicles, which may have more powerful engines, larger electrical systems, and additional accessories.

The Advantages of Higher Voltage Batteries

Higher voltage batteries offer several advantages over their 12-volt counterparts, particularly in applications with heavy electrical loads.

  • Increased Power Output: Higher voltage batteries can deliver more current, allowing them to power more demanding electrical components and accessories.
  • Reduced Current Draw: For a given power output, higher voltage batteries require less current to flow, which can reduce the strain on the electrical system and wiring.
  • Improved Starting Performance: Higher voltage batteries can provide a more powerful initial jolt to the starter motor, making it easier to start the engine, especially in cold weather.

Understanding Battery Voltage and State of Charge

The voltage of a car battery is a direct indicator of its state of charge. A fully charged battery will have a voltage closer to 12.6 volts, while a discharged battery will have a voltage closer to 12 volts or even lower. Factors Affecting Battery Voltage

Several factors can influence the voltage of a car battery, including:

  • Temperature: Battery voltage tends to be lower in cold temperatures and higher in warm temperatures.
  • Age: As batteries age, their ability to hold a charge diminishes, resulting in lower voltage readings.
  • Load: When electrical components are drawing power from the battery, the voltage will drop slightly.
  • Charging System: A faulty charging system may not be able to fully recharge the battery, leading to low voltage.

Testing Battery Voltage

A simple way to check the voltage of a car battery is to use a voltmeter. This handheld device measures the electrical potential difference between two points. To test a car battery, connect the voltmeter’s positive (+) lead to the positive (+) terminal of the battery and the negative (-) lead to the negative (-) terminal. The voltmeter will display the voltage reading in volts.

Interpreting Battery Voltage Readings

Here’s a general guide to interpreting battery voltage readings:

  • 12.6 volts or higher: Fully charged battery
  • 12.4-12.6 volts: Good charge
  • 12.2-12.4 volts: Fair charge, may need recharging
  • Below 12.2 volts: Discharged battery, requires charging or replacement

Maintaining Battery Health

  • Regularly check the battery voltage: Use a voltmeter to monitor the battery’s charge level and identify any potential issues early on.
  • Keep the battery terminals clean: Corrosion on the battery terminals can hinder electrical connections and reduce battery performance. Clean the terminals with a wire brush and baking soda solution.
  • Avoid deep discharges: Letting the battery completely discharge can damage it. If you’re not using your car for an extended period, disconnect the battery to prevent it from draining.
  • Have the battery tested periodically: Take your car to a mechanic or auto parts store to have the battery tested for its health and capacity.

What happens if my car battery is too low?

If your car battery is too low, it may struggle to start your engine. You might notice symptoms like slow cranking, dim headlights, or warning lights on the dashboard. In severe cases, a completely discharged battery may prevent your car from starting at all.

How long does a car battery last?

The lifespan of a car battery typically ranges from 3 to 5 years. However, factors like driving habits, climate conditions, and battery maintenance can influence its longevity.

Can I jump-start a car with a dead battery?

Yes, you can jump-start a car with a dead battery using jumper cables and a working car battery. Be sure to connect the cables in the correct order to avoid damaging the electrical systems.

What is the best way to charge a car battery?

The best way to charge a car battery is using a battery charger specifically designed for automotive batteries. These chargers provide a controlled and safe charging process.

How do I know if my car battery needs to be replaced?
